Nayagram in context

With 483 people at the 2011 Census, Nayagram was the 3360th most populous of its district's 8695 villages, below the district average of 597.

Literacy stood at 60.05%, 16.8 points below the district's rural average of 76.87%.

The sex ratio was 1147 women per 1,000 men (182 above the district's rural figure of 965)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1708, 785 above the rural national 923.
